A lightweight track-only variant of the Porsche 981 Cayman GT4, the Clubsport model comes equipped with a 6-speed PDK transmission, GT3 Cup-derived suspension, adjustable ABS, an FIA-certified roll cage, a racing bucket seat, and a Krontec air jack system. This 2016 example features a Manthey-Racing MR Performance kit which adds adjustable KW coilovers, a blade-style front sway bar, brake-bias adjustment, a carbon-fiber hood, doors, and a larger rear wing. The car is also equipped with a Salzburg livery exterior wrap, a Manthey Racing lighting package, an AiM digital dash, Garmin Catalyst driving performance optimizer, cool suit plumbing, and a radio communication system. This GT4 Clubsport MR was imported by the seller from Germany in 2020 and sold to a private owner who participated in HPDE courses and a few Porsche Club of America club races. Accompanied by a PCA racing logbook and documented service history, this GT4 Clubsport MR is now being offered for auction out of Illinois with just over 4k kilometers on the odometer.
The exterior wears a custom Salzburg-style vinyl livery over white paint. It comes equipped with the Manthey-Racing MR Performance kit which includes a lightweight carbon fiber hood and doors, a polycarbonate windscreen, and a larger rear wing. The Manthey-Racing lighting package also features halogen lamps integrated into the front bumper. Other equipment includes a front splitter, side air scoops, OMP tow straps, a rear diffuser, a Lexan rear window, and dual center-mounted exhaust tips. The car rides on 18” BBS forged aluminum wheels dressed in used Pirelli P Zero racing slicks. An additional set of BBS wheels is included in the sale. The seller reports the car never sustained accident damage and retains its original paint beneath the vinyl wrap. Detailed images are provided in the gallery.
Inside, this GT4 features a stripped-out racing cockpit equipped with an FIA welded-in roll cage, a Recaro P1300 racing seat, a Sabelt 6-point safety harness, carbon fiber door panels, and an Alcantara-wrapped flat-bottom steering wheel with carbon fiber paddle shifters. Other equipment includes a fire suppression system, an AiM digital dashboard, a Garmin Catalyst driving performance optimizer, cool suit plumbing, a radio communication system, and a carbon fiber central switch panel.
A mid-mounted 3.8-liter flat-six engine delivers 385 HP to the rear wheels through a 6-speed PDK racing transmission and a locking differential. Factory performance features include Performance Friction (PFC) brakes, an adjustable Bosch 12-step Porsche Motorsport ABS module, a 911 GT3 Cup-derived front suspension, and a Krontec air jack system. The Cup-specific brakes also include a dual master cylinder brake system with a driver brake bias knob. The Manthey-Racing MR Performance kit includes a lightweight battery, a brake bias adjuster, a blade-style front sway bar, and adjustable KW coilovers. An in date FIA certification is not required for racing in Porsche Club of America, SCCA or NASA. An in date fuel cell is a requirement for IMSA, SRO or Porsche Sprint Challenge and this car is not eligible for those series. Most of the cars you see entered in amateur racing series do not have an in date FIA certification.
